What Are Stem Cells?
Stem cells are undifferentiated cells capable of creating into various cell types, such as muscle mass cells, nerve cells, or blood cells. There are several types of stem cells, including:

Embryonic Stem Cells (ESCs): Derived from early-phase embryos, these cells are pluripotent, this means they may become any mobile key in your body.

Adult Stem Cells (Somatic Stem Cells): Found in tissues like bone marrow, pores and skin, as well as liver, these cells are multipotent, indicating they could build into a restricted range of mobile sorts.

Induced Pluripotent Stem Cells (iPSCs): They're adult cells that were genetically reprogrammed to behave like embryonic stem cells, giving excellent potential for individualized medication.

The Promise of Stem Mobile Therapy
Stem cell therapy holds immense probable in dealing with conditions which were as soon as thought of incurable. Several of the important purposes contain:

Regenerative Medicine
Stem cells can mend or change harmed tissues and organs. This is particularly promising for disorders including:

Spinal wire injuries – Stem cells may perhaps support regenerate nerve cells.

Heart disease – They could restore harmed coronary heart tissue after a coronary heart attack.

Diabetes – Stem cells could most likely regenerate insulin-creating pancreatic cells.

Neurological Conditions
Study is ongoing for employing stem cells to take care of neurodegenerative ailments like:

Parkinson’s sickness (replacing dropped dopamine-developing neurons)

Alzheimer’s illness (fixing Mind tissue)

ALS (Amyotrophic Lateral Sclerosis) (slowing sickness progression)

Orthopedic Therapies
Stem mobile therapy is increasingly used in orthopedics to deal with:

Osteoarthritis (fixing cartilage)

Bone fractures (accelerating therapeutic)

Tendon and ligament accidents

Autoimmune and Blood Disorders
Stem cell transplants (bone marrow transplants) have already been correctly used to treat:

Leukemia

Lymphoma

Sickle cell anemia
